Murf AI is a Bengaluru-based AI voice generation company that provides a browser-based voiceover studio with over 120 AI voices in 20 languages for creating professional-quality audio narrations. The platform is designed for content creators, marketers, learning and development professionals, and product teams who need voice narration without recording sessions or professional voice actors. Murf's studio interface allows users to type or paste a script, select a voice, adjust speed and pitch, and synchronize audio with video or presentation slides, producing broadcast-quality narration in minutes. The company's voices are trained to deliver natural intonation and emotional tone appropriate for professional content rather than monotonic robotic speech. Murf serves over 3 million users globally including teams at Amazon, Accenture, and LinkedIn who use it for e-learning modules, product demo videos, and customer-facing content. Founded in 2020, Murf raised funding from Matrix Partners India and has grown rapidly in the creator and enterprise voice content market.

100ms is a live audio and video infrastructure platform that provides developers with SDKs and APIs for embedding real-time communication features — video rooms, audio spaces, live streams, and recording — into web and mobile applications. The platform is designed around a room-based model where developers programmatically create, configure, and manage video rooms through a REST API, with client SDKs for React, iOS, Android, Flutter, and React Native handling the media layer. This abstraction allows teams to build fully custom video experiences with their own UI without dealing with WebRTC internals, TURN server management, or media server infrastructure.
